INSTALLATION
CAUTION
Antiseizing tape must be used on all pipe threads to provide a good seal and to prevent threaded parts
from seizing.
NOTE
For more information on how to use antiseizing tape, go to General Maintenance Instructions.
18 Union (1)
Hose (2)
a
Wrap pipe threads with antiseizing tape
(page 2-424).
b
Screw in and tighten using 1 3/8-inch
and 1 1/2-inch open-end wrenches.
19 Nipple (3)
Elbow (4)
Screw in and tighten using 18-inch pipe
wrench.
20 Elbow (4)
Elbow (5)
a
Wrap pipe threads with antiseizing tape
(page 2-424).
b
Screw in and tighten using 1 1/2-inch
open-end wrench and 18-inch pipe
wrench.
21 Elbow (5)
Hose (2)
a
Wrap pipe thread with antiseizing tape
(page 2-424).
b
Screw in and tighten using 1 3/8-inch
and 1 1/2-inch open-end wrenches.
22 Nipple (3)
Elbow (6)
Screw in and tighten using 18-inch pipe
wrench.
